One bedroom south facing apartment for sale in Veliko Tarnovo

One-bedroom apartment located in a newly built luxury building in Kartala, Veliko Tarnovo.

The total area of ​​the property is 70 sq m, of which 6.3 sq m is a basement. The apartment consists of a bedroom, a living room with a kitchen and a dining area, a terrace, a bathroom / toilet and a corridor.

The finishing meets the Bulgarian standards - on plaster and putty, PVC windows with triple glazing, MDF interior doors, armored front door, exterior insulation. The exposure is south. The building is gasified.

The location of the residential complex offers everything you need for your comfort, security and free time of your whole family. This is a great place to live with all the necessary amenities. The apartment is right next to the park, near public transport, restaurants and so on.

The complex has its own courtyard with landscaping and a children’s playground.
